[Study on the alkaloids from the stem of Zanthoxylum dissitum]
Can Xiao1, Yuan Yuan, Yang-zhou Ding
1School of Pharmacy, Hunan university of Chinese Medicine, Changsha 410208, China. cc64306070@yahoo.cn
Objective:
To study the alkaloids from the stems of Zanthoxylum dissitum.
Methods:
Added ammonia to the 0.5% HCl extract solution of the plants until the pH was 11 to collect the total alkaloids. Using the chromatography of alumina and silica gel to separate the alkaloids. According to the physicochemical properties and spectral analysis to elucidate the structures of the constitutes.
Results:
Four compounds were isolated and identified as nitidine (I), sanguinarine (II), zanthobungeanine (III), dictamnine (IV).
Conclusion:
Besides dictamnine, three others are isolated from the rhizome of the plant for the first time.
